The Mamanuca islands (Nadi)
This band of small islands, which have great beaches and world class diving, can be seen on a clear day. On some of the islands there is a bit of rainforest left where it is possible to see reptiles and many exotic birds. Boats to the island go out from Nadi on regular intervals but there are also good opportunities to stay on the islands overnight.
The Sigatoka Valley (Nadi)
Several interesting archaeological finds can be seen in a valley South of Navi. The valley is situated in one of the most beautiful areas on Viti Levu. The town of Sigatoka is a very charming place, which is said to one of the best locations to get earthenware.
The Sri Siva Subramaniya Temple (Nadi)
The largest Hindu temple in the Tropic of Capricorn can be seen in Nadi. It is a building with very distinct architectural features. It has been painted in bright colours and it has been erected in honour of the god Murugan. The temple is open to visitors who have not drunk any alcohol or eaten any meat on the day of their visit.
